What is a potential security issue with magnetic stripes?
They are too expensive to produce.
Criminals can easily obtain card readers and writers.
They require complex training to use.
They cannot be altered.
Answer explanation
The correct choice highlights that criminals can easily obtain card readers and writers, allowing them to clone magnetic stripe cards. This poses a significant security risk, as it facilitates fraud and unauthorized transactions.
